Are you a proactive, creative, and detail-oriented individual ready to build foundational skills in a dynamic educational environment?
Leigh Academies Trust is seeking a highly motivated Marketing/Digital Apprentice to join our team. This role offers a vital supportive position in the development and delivery of high-quality, engaging digital content across various platforms. Aligned with the Level 3 Multi-Channel Marketer Apprenticeship Standard, this opportunity provides hands-on experience and a structured learning journey to accelerate your professional development.
Key Responsibilities: Driving Digital Engagement
You will work closely with the Marketing Manager and our Web, Media, and Design teams to amplify our online presence and drive customer engagement.
Content Creation & Optimisation: Assist in creating, editing, and optimising content (video, visual, written) for key platforms like TikTok, Instagram, and YouTube, ensuring adherence to brand guidelines.
Website Management: Support the effective use of Content Management Systems (CMS) by adding and enhancing content across Trust and Academy websites.
Campaign Support & Analysis: Contribute to strategic content planning and assist with campaign collaboration, including using web and social media analytics tools to evaluate performance and inform future strategy.
Innovation & Research: Explore new technologies and research the latest marketing trends, particularly in education, including the responsible and effective use of AI models to streamline workflow.
Desired Skills and Attributes
We are looking for a driven team player with excellent communication skills and a genuine interest in digital marketing and emerging technologies.
Digital Proficiency: A foundational understanding of digital platforms, social media, and an interest in photography, filmmaking, and editing.
Technical Aptitude: Familiarity with content creation tools and a willingness to learn about copywriting, SEO techniques, and media asset management.
Professional Skills: Strong attention to detail, excellent organisational skills, and a proven ability to work effectively as part of a collaborative team.

Our Commitment to Safeguarding, Equality & Diversity
Leigh Academies Trust and all of our academies are committed to ensuring the highest levels of safeguarding and promoting the welfare of our pupils, and we expect all our staff and volunteers to share this commitment. We adopt a fair, robust and consistent recruitment process across all academies and business units which is inline with Keeping Children Safe in Education guidance. This includes online checks for shortlisted candidates - you can read more about this in our . All offers of employment are subject to an Enhanced DBS check, references, and where applicable, a prohibition from teaching check.
As a Trust, we are passionate about diversity and recognise that as individuals, we all bring something unique to the role regardless of any protected characteristics which is why we treat all of our people equally, without compromise. We are committed to providing equality and fairness throughout our recruitment and employment practices and not discriminating on any grounds.
